IAF officer arrested for alleged leak of sensitive information to Pakistan-based operative

Source: The Hindu

Introduction

A significant security breach has emerged within the Indian Air Force (IAF) following the arrest of an officer accused of compromising classified defense information. The official is alleged to have funneled sensitive data to a handler based in Pakistan, sparking a major internal investigation into potential espionage and the compromise of national security protocols.

The arrest underscores the persistent challenges defense organizations face regarding digital communications and the increasing sophistication of foreign intelligence operations. As authorities continue to process the case, the IAF officer arrested for alleged leak of sensitive information to Pakistan-based operative remains at the center of a high-stakes inquiry into how internal security barriers were bypassed.

What Happened

The apprehension of the officer was the direct result of a proactive monitoring campaign conducted by the internal intelligence division of the Indian Air Force. Military investigators identified a pattern of suspicious activity that necessitated a formal handover to broader national security agencies for further interrogation and forensic analysis.

The investigative trail began when the officer's digital footprint and interpersonal communications triggered an automated security alert. It was discovered that the individual had been maintaining consistent, unauthorized contact with an operative linked to Pakistan, leading to the eventual decision to take the officer into custody to prevent further dissemination of state secrets.
